An individual so sexually deviant he Jacks off in the ladies room, ask other guys if he can help them jack off, brags about jacking off with both hands to every guy at Davis College, and had sex with his own mom
Dave Leathers is more sexually deviant then Glenn Quagmire
by CrotchDocter87 July 22, 2019
Get the Dave Leathers mug.